About this blog
What was meant to be a month long trip, has turned into a way of life. I had set out to drive with my only companion being my pitbull, Brody, from Vancouver, BC to Mexico and once I arrived in Mexico City, I found myself renting an apartment and looking for work.
Since my first visit to Mexico City when I was 18 years old, I fell in love with it - the chaos, the culture, the people, the language, the sounds. It only seemed fitting to stick around a while and see what could happen once I ended up here again 2 years later. I don't know when I'm going back - the whole word is out there waiting and I've only seen an incredible 4% of it, but for now, this is where I'm meant to be.
ps - I have named this trip "El Condor Pasa" (loosely translates to "The condor [a type of vulture] flies by) after one of my favorite Simon and Garfunkel songs - it just seems appropriate.
